This study reports on bonding possibility of pure niobium (Nb). Bonding was carried out at 940°C for 2-8 h. XRD analysis revealed that the dominant phase formed in coating layer is NbB<inf>2</inf>. Optical cross-sectional image of borided Nb showed that borides formed on the surface of Nb has a smooth and compact morphology. The hardness of borides measured by means of Vickers indenter is over than 2000 HV. © 2008 Elsevier B.V., All rights reserved.
